Carbon Brick, a refractory material, is made from carbon – based substances like anthracite and graphite. It has high temperature resistance, low thermal expansion, and excellent corrosion resistance, widely used in steel and chemical industries.

1.High – temp resistance: Withstands extreme heat stably.
2.Low thermal expansion: Resists cracking from temp changes.
3.Strong corrosion resistance: Defends against acidic and alkaline media.
4.Good thermal conductivity: Transfers heat efficiently.
Carbon bricks are used in blast furnaces for iron – making, lining reactors in chemical plants, and as linings in non – ferrous metal smelting furnaces due to their unique properties.
